Our Method:

The Prism of Balance

The Prism of Balance is both a symbol and a guide. Its golden form reflects our shared understanding that Human–CI collaboration grows in stages, each level offering new clarity and possibility.

We recognize that our way is not the only way, but this way has worked for us—and it has brought balance, clarity and amplification.

The pyramid shape itself is deliberate: Five tiers representing the five levels of our method: forming a foundation of simplicity and practicality, showing both the light and the shadow in balance, rising toward light and openness and culminating in the radiant beams of amplification that shine outward.

The Prism of Balance represents the stages of Human–CI collaboration, moving from simple interactions toward profound co-adaptation and amplification. Each level carries both light (benefits) and shadow (potential pitfalls), showing the importance of balance at every stage.

Level 3: Collaboration

Light: Collaboration begins when CI is no longer seen as a program, but as a partner. Ideas are exchanged, explored, and refined together. The Human learns to hold the mirror safely. Creativity expands as the Human and CI bring out new dimensions in one another.

Shadow: Collaboration can tilt into dependency if Humans neglect their own intuition. CI mirrors back what is given — and if the input is unbalanced, the reflection may reinforce unhealthy patterns.

Level 4: Co-Adaptation

Light: Here, both Human and CI adjust to one another. The CI learns the rhythms, language, and values of the Human, while the Human learns how to frame, pace, and guide interactions for maximum clarity. Together, the whole becomes more than the sum of its parts.

Shadow: The risk is absorption — losing sight of boundaries. Humans must remember rest, Human responsibilities and relationships, even while drawn into the clarity CI provides.

Level 1: Tasks

Light: At this level, Humans learn to use CI for straightforward, practical actions. Examples include asking for reminders, checking facts, or generating lists. These tasks free up mental bandwidth, letting Humans focus on what matters most.

Shadow: The risk lies in over-reliance — using CI as a crutch for even the simplest decisions. This can dull Human initiative and intuition if balance is not maintained.

Level 2: Tool

Light: CI becomes a versatile tool — helping write, design, organize, or problem-solve. The Human directs, CI assists, and together the results are stronger than either could achieve alone.

Shadow: Without mindful use, tools can overwhelm. Too many prompts, too many outputs, and the clarity is lost. The key is using tools to amplify, not clutter.

Level 5: Amplification

Light: At the pinnacle, collaboration radiates outward. Human and CI amplify one another, and the effects spill into wider communities. Balance creates not just efficiency but wisdom, not just answers but transformation.


Shadow:
If reached without balance, amplification can magnify distortions. The mirror can become a funhouse reflection, justifying unhealthy impulses. True amplification only emerges when balance is honored at every stage.
